Chemistry Check: Are You Really Compatible?

Start by naming what matters to you beyond attraction. Whether you’re exploring connections with cougars or anyone older or younger, clarity about relationship goals, lifestyle, and deal-breakers helps you move from curiosity to a real assessment of fit.

Key Areas To Explore

  • Relationship goals: Ask early whether you both picture casual dating, a committed partnership, or something with flexible boundaries. Share timelines and openness to change so expectations don’t drift apart.
  • Values and priorities: Talk about family, work, health, finances, and how you each spend your free time. Similar priorities reduce friction even when day-to-day habits differ.
  • Lifestyle fit: Discuss routines, travel habits, social energy, and home life. Compatibility here makes day-to-day life smoother—nothing kills chemistry faster than constant mismatch in basic routines.
  • Communication style: Notice how you talk about feelings, conflicts, and logistics. Do you prefer direct check-ins, gentle updates, or scheduled conversations? Agreeing on how to communicate prevents misunderstandings.
  • Boundaries and respect: Be explicit about personal boundaries—time, privacy, social media, and past relationships. Respecting boundaries builds trust and keeps chemistry healthy.

Thoughtful Questions To Ask

  1. What does a satisfying relationship look like to you right now?
  2. How do you balance independence and together time?
  3. What are your non-negotiables in a partnership?
  4. How do you handle disagreements or stress?
  5. What role do family and friends play in your life?

Keep questions conversational and reciprocal. Share your own answers rather than turning the chat into an interview—compatibility is a two-way discovery. If you notice consistent mismatches on core areas, it’s okay to acknowledge that chemistry alone won’t carry a relationship. Use what you learn to decide whether to deepen the connection, set clearer boundaries, or move on respectfully.

Dating Confidence Reset: Practical Steps To Feel Grounded

If you feel tired of slow replies, awkward chats, or matches that fizzle, start with a simple reset: clarify what you want so every message and swipe aligns with that goal. Spend 10–15 minutes writing down your top two priorities (for example: casual conversation, meeting within a month, or exploring long-term potential). Use those priorities to guide who you message and how you respond.

Set realistic expectations and pace

Dating online is a process, not a sprint. Limit yourself to a manageable number of active conversations—three to five is a good starting point—so you don’t burn out. Move from text to voice or video on your timeline (for example, after a few days of steady messaging) and aim for an in-person meet within a timeframe that feels comfortable and safe for you. Give people a chance to show consistency, but don’t wait forever for someone to decide.

Keep emotional steadiness without ignoring your needs

Protect your energy by deciding in advance what feels acceptable in conversation and what doesn’t. If someone regularly cancels, gives one-word replies, or avoids basic questions about values, treat that as useful information rather than a personal failure. Politely step back when boundaries are crossed and re-engage when you feel ready.

Notice small progress and stay intentional

Track simple wins: a thoughtful reply, a shared laugh, or a planned date. These are signs of momentum even if they don’t lead to something serious. Periodically review your priorities and adjust who you pursue. If a pattern of disappointment shows up, refine your filters—be more selective about profiles that match your core needs.

Choose matches thoughtfully, not by numbers

Avoid the numbers-game mindset that rewards quantity over fit. Instead, scan profiles for two or three indicators that matter to you—a hobby, a communication style, or a value—and use those as your first cut. Send messages that reflect curiosity and specificity, which attract more meaningful replies.
